Smith & Wesson Brands, Inc. engages in the design, manufacture, and sale of firearms worldwide. It offers handguns, including revolvers and pistols; long guns, such as modern sporting rifles, pistol caliber carbines, and lever-action rifles; handcuffs; suppressors; and other firearm-related products. It also provides manufacturing services comprising forging, heat treating, rapid prototyping, tooling, finishing, plating, machining, and custom plastic injection molding, assembly, and distribution services to other businesses; and sells parts purchased through third parties. The company sells its products to firearm enthusiasts, collectors, hunters, sportsmen, competitive shooters, individuals desiring home and personal protection, law enforcement, security agencies and officers, and military agencies. It markets its products through independent dealers, retailers, in-store retails, and direct to consumers, and range operations; print, broadcast, and digital advertising campaigns; social and electronic media; and in-store retail merchandising strategies. The company was founded in 1852 and is based in Maryville, Tennessee.
